Output f51e514f8cdeeb863f1d9b1202b7ed41e81e4c96fbb70896154e2400d1dc7096:1

value
1985835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 156269e65dacc8bd5f9f74d16409a30cf09ebc72 OP_EQUAL
address
33e61USdw5Jq7oAZzi4xobfr4QQZNiH64g
transaction
f51e514f8cdeeb863f1d9b1202b7ed41e81e4c96fbb70896154e2400d1dc7096
confirmations
167234
spent
true